Op deze website gebruiken we cookies om content en advertenties te personaliseren, om functies voor social media te bieden en om ons websiteverkeer te analyseren. Ook delen we informatie over uw gebruik van onze site met onze partners voor social media, adverteren en analyse. Deze partners kunnen deze gegevens combineren met andere informatie die u aan ze heeft verstrekt of die ze hebben verzameld op basis van uw gebruik van hun services. Meer informatie.

Akkoord

Vraag & Antwoord

Webprogrammeren & scripting

[MySQL] Table repeaten met data uit database

None
3 antwoorden
  • Ik wil met mijn site een kleine wedstrijd organiseren, Heel leuk. :P

    Maar nu het probleem, Om mijzelf het makkelijker te maken (en de leden)

    Heb ik een lijst opgesteld die alle data uit een database table pakt, Is nog gelukt ook. . maarja

    Nu laat hij maar 1 regel zien uit de database, met een fout erbij. En als ik de fout kan wegwerken laat hij alles uit de database zien, zo heb ik het ingesteld, Weet ik 100% zeker.. Maar om een of andere reden gaat het niet

    De pagina is kwestie staat hier: http://www.parkietenweb.nl/deelnemers.php

    Dit is de broncode van die pagina:

    [code:1:07ae6363dc]<?php require_once('Connections/Default.php'); ?>
    <? include"top.php"; ?>
    <?php
    mysql_select_db($database_Default, $Default);
    $query_Recordset1 = "SELECT * FROM wedstrijd";
    $Recordset1 = mysql_query($query_Recordset1, $Default) or die(mysql_error());
    $row_Recordset1 = mysql_fetch_assoc($Recordset1);
    $totalRows_Recordset1 = mysql_num_rows($Recordset1);

    mysql_free_result($Recordset1);
    ?>

    <table width="100%" border="1">
    <tr>
    <td><strong>Naam</strong></td>
    <td><strong>Ronde</strong></td>
    <td><strong>Punten</strong></td>
    </tr>
    <?php do { ?>
    <tr>
    <td><?php echo $row_Recordset1['naam']; ?></td>
    <td><?php echo $row_Recordset1['ronde']; ?></td>
    <td><?php echo $row_Recordset1['punten']; ?></td>
    </tr>
    <?php } while ($row_Recordset1 = mysql_fetch_assoc($Recordset1)); ?>
    </table>
    <? include"bottom.php"; ?>[/code:1:07ae6363dc]

    dit is dan zo'n klik and install pagina van dreamweaver. maar hij werkt bijna op dit kleine dingetje na :S

    Iemand ideeen?
  • [code:1:a2f926a80e]mysql_free_result($Recordset1); [/code:1:a2f926a80e]
    Haal dat eens weg. Of verplaats het naar het einde van je script, dus na
    [code:1:a2f926a80e]<?php } while ($row_Recordset1 = mysql_fetch_assoc($Recordset1)); ?> [/code:1:a2f926a80e]
    De opdracht mysql_free_result verwijdert de recordset uit het geheugen.
    [quote:a2f926a80e]mysql_free_result

    (PHP 3, PHP 4 , PHP 5)
    mysql_free_result – Maak geheugen van het resultaat vrij
    Beschrijving
    bool mysql_free_result ( resource result)

    mysql_free_result() zal al het geheugen vrij maken dat is geassocieerd met de result identifier result.

    mysql_free_result() hoeft alleen te worden aangeroepen als je je zorgen maakt over de hoeveelheid geheugen die wordt gebruikt voor queries die grote resultaten teruggeven. Al het geassocieerde geheugen wordt automatisch vrijgemaakt aan het eind van de executie van het script.

    Geeft TRUE terug bij succes, FALSE indien er een fout is opgetreden.

    Voor compatibiliteit kan mysql_freeresult() ook gebruikt worden. Dit wordt echter afgekeurd. [/quote:a2f926a80e]
  • Bedankt! Het werkt!

Beantwoord deze vraag

Dit is een gearchiveerde pagina. Antwoorden is niet meer mogelijk.